OX BOTTOM MANOR COMMUNITY ASSOCIATION, INC.
MINUTES OF THE BOARD OF DIRECTORS MEETING
MARCH 11, 2003

 

Meeting held at Bannerman Place, 1508 Bannerman Road, 6:30 p.m.
Board members present:

Robert Hicks, Steve Spook, Steve Stolting and Sharon Elsberry

Meeting called to order at 6:35 p.m. by President, Robert Hicks

The board elected the following officers:
Robert Hicks- President
Melinda Halvorsen-Vice President
Steve Spook-Secretary
Steve, Stolting- Board Member
Sharon Elsberry- Treasurer

Assignment of board member’s tasks/duties:
Melinda Halvorsen: Legal Contact/Fall Picnic
Robert Hicks: Landscape
Steve Spook: ACC
Steve Stolting: Maintenance/Repairs
Sharon Elsberry: floater
Motion to approve board assignments and position: Steve Stolting
Second: Sharon
Vote: all in favor

Financial Reports for January and February 2003 submitted. Total assets as of February 28, 2003 were $105,187.44.
Motion to accept financial reports: Steve Spook
Second: Steve Stolting
Vote: all in favor

Budget Adjustments: The board voted to make several changes to the 2003 budget. The changes are as follows:
Capital Improvements increased to $13,000.00
Legal Services decreased to $5,000.00
Fall Picnic increased to $6,000.00
Miscellaneous decreased to $2,328.25

Irrigation Repair:
Jason Black submitted an irrigation repair report including a proposal to repair the electrical problem at the Spanish Moss entrance. Motion to accept Jason’s estimate at $200-$400: Sharon
Second: Steve Spook
Vote: all in favor

David Theriaque sent a list of pending legal items. The board officially acknowledged approval of the Barlow’s plan to screen their RV. The fence is completed and the landscaping will be installed by April 8, 2003.
Motion by Steve Spook: Deadline for completion, April 8, 2003
Second: Sharon
Vote: all in favor

Legal Representative:
The board voted previously to have Robert Hicks meet with the association attorney, David Theriaque, to discuss the legal spending and to offer a monthly retainer fee in an attempt to lower the fees assessed to the community. Robert reported that David said he is not interested in a retainer arrangement at all and was not certain that he wished to continue representing the association.

David will call Robert on Wednesday to give his answer on whether or not he wishes to remain as legal counsel for Ox Bottom Manor.

Pool and pool house plan on Quail Ridge submitted for ACC approval reviewed and discussed. Steve & Bryan reviewed the site and recommended a variance for this plan. The board members will review the plan before voting to issue the variance for the setback.
